According to the public record, 44, Gwynne Road, Poole is an early-century freehold house with 850 ft2 of internal area and sits on a 194 m2 plot.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 3 bedrooms with a garden.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for 44, Gwynne Road, Poole is £320,297 and the estimated rental value is £1,615 per month.

Decorative condition can have a big effect on a property's value and this effect varies depending on the type, size and location of the property.
If 44, Gwynne Road, Poole is in very good condition we estimate a sale value of £336,312 and a rental value of £1,695 per month.
However, if the property needs a lot of cosmetic work we estimate a sale value of £297,876 and a rental value of £1,502 per month.
Over the past 12 months, the estimated sale value of 44, Gwynne Road, Poole has decreased by £11,576 (3.6%), while its estimated rental value has grown by £61 per month (3.8%). Based on current estimates, the property offers a gross rental yield of 6.0%.

44, Gwynne Road, Poole has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of D.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 30 Mar 2026.
The property is conn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.
According to HM Land Registry, 44, Gwynne Road, Poole was last sold on 28th August 2013 for £185,000 and was recorded as a freehold house.
The property has had 2 sales since 1995.
Since August 2013, the market for similar properties has risen by 58.6%.
